    The bathroom slab is generally lowered by about 100, and the surrounding beam height is generally greater than 200, so that even if your floor slab is 100 thick, the slab is still within the support of the beam, that is, the support of the beam or the slab. As for the negative reinforcement, of course, it cannot be penetrated with the adjacent slabs, because the elevation is different and cannot be penetrated, so the negative reinforcement can be considered to extend into the beam.

    The bathroom does not have a drop plate, which means that the drainage pipe of your bathroom is on the top of the next bathroom;

    However, the drainage pipe on the top of your bathroom is from a resident upstairs, and it is made in this way of different-layer drainage;

    The problem is that there is nothing wrong with it, it can be used for residential purposes.
